Lutz Surgical Partners charged us over $84,000 for TWO of its surgeons (why two?) to do a 45-minute, emergency laparascopic appendectomy on my 15-year-old son. Take a close look at that number. EIGHTY-FOUR THOUSAND DOLLARS. Forty-two thousand for one surgeon, and forty-two thousand for another surgeon. This is independent of the hospital and emergency-room charges. This is just for each of the surgeons. No facility. The best part is that, within a month of getting our bill, Lutz Surgical Partners sent us to collections. If this is what you are looking for in a surgeon, good luck. This has been our nightmare. It has pretty much torn my family apart, ruined our finances, and caused great suffering.
UPDATE: Lutz Surgical Partners was eventually successful in negotiating with Blue Cross and settled for half of the original bill. I received a BCBS document stating that we have no personal liability for the negotiated amount and that Lutz Surgical Partners will not bill us for the balance. We'll see.

Similar to others- I was seen in the ER and told "your insurance will cover it". After nearly 3 YEARS of dealing with the collection agency - yes, they sent me to collections after my insurance company refused to pay their outlandish billing request- without so much as a phone call or explanation -the bill was finally settled. Let's be clear- the price for the surgeon should have been ‎$5,812 to $11,052. Judging from the reviews of others it looks like it's common practice to charge 10-20 times (that's not an exaggeration) the normal price when the patient is in the ER.

If you are looking at this review then it most likely means that they pulled the same thing on you and all I can tell you is I feel for you. The stress and worry placed on me and my family has been an absolute nightmare.

If you are in the hospital waiting to be seen by them or waiting on your procedure- DO NOT let them put you under until you get a SIGNED agreement that they will accept the amount your insurance will reimburse. DO NOT fall for the slick "Trust me I'm a Dr.- your insurance HAS to pay" - because it's simply NOT true.

I have to agree with other reviews I believe a lawyer needs to look into this. i went into an in network Hospital (Oak Hill)they said i needed surgery to remove my Appendix. (I do have United Health care that I pay for) .the produre was 30 min according to paperwork and i just had to pay my deductible. Then about a month later i got a bill for $42,789.00 that i had to pay since they were out of network.Out of that the surgeon charged $22,000 and the assistant charged $22,000. How does the assistant make just as much as the surgeon ??? I argued that with UHC but they did not budge. about a month in a half i got a letter from a collection agency Rockford Mercantile which seems to work with Lutz Surgical Partners. they sent me a letter to appeal UHC after about 1 year arguging UHC paid the surgeon not the assistant stating it was Ineligable ? just today i received another letter from the collection agency stating i have to pay $22,000 to the assistant , UHC says they will not pay it.
